Gaining In-Depth Posture Understanding Through 3D Software Applications
In the realm of physical therapy and ergonomics, understanding posture plays a pivotal role in assessing and addressing musculoskeletal imbalances. Traditionally, assessments have relied on visual inspections and subjective indications. However, the advent of cutting-edge 3D software has revolutionized this, providing clinicians and researchers with a more detailed and holistic view of human posture.
- Leveraging sophisticated 3D modeling techniques, these software platforms capture instantaneous postural data with remarkable accuracy.
- This advancements enable the pinpointing of subtle discrepancies in spinal alignment, muscle imbalances, and gross posture patterns.
- Moreover, 3D software facilitates the construction of virtual representations of the human body, allowing clinicians to illustrate postural issues in a clear and understandable manner.
Consequently, the integration of 3D software into postural analysis workflows enhances assessment accuracy, facilitates precise treatment planning, and empowers individuals to take control for their posture health.

Beyond Static Images: Dynamic Posture Analysis in Action
Traditional posture analysis often relies on static images, capturing a single moment in time. This limited snapshot can't fully reveal the nuances of human movement and postural change. Dynamic posture analysis, however, takes a novel approach by tracking movement over time. Utilizing sensors and advanced algorithms, this technique offers a more comprehensive understanding of how our bodies shift throughout the day. By analyzing these dynamic trends, we can identify subtle postural imbalances that may not be apparent in static images.
